John E. Knepper, 66 of East Liverpool, Ohio passed away unexpectedly at his home on Tuesday, February 11, 2020.
He was born in New Castle, PA on January 12, 1954 a son to the late John D. and Kathleen (Fettes) Knepper. Living his entire life in this area, John was a 1972 graduate of Beaver Local High School, worked in the Sales Department for O.S. Hill Company and attended Northside Community Church.
He is survived by his wife Judy (Burns) Knepper of Calcutta, OH; a son: Ryan Knepper of Calcutta, OH; two brothers: Don Knepper and his wife Kathy of Calcutta, OH and Jim Knepper of Celina, Texas; a granddaughter: Grace Knepper and several nieces and nephews; two step-sons: Randy Gaskill and his wife Maria and Scott Gaskill both of East Liverpool, OH and a step-daughter: Kellie McElhaney of East Liverpool, OH.
In addition to his parents he was preceded in death by two daughters: Casey Shasteen and Amanda Dawn Knepper.
